Proposed Solutions and Initiatives
Various countries are presenting their strategies to combat climate change, showcasing innovative solutions aimed at sustainability.
Notable Initiatives:
- Carbon Pricing: Several nations are advocating for the implementation of carbon pricing mechanisms to incentivize emissions reductions.
- Reforestation Projects: Countries are pledging efforts to restore forests, which play a crucial role in absorbing carbon dioxide.
- Green Technology Development: Investments in new technologies aimed at reducing pollution are high on the agenda, including electric vehicles and energy-efficient systems.
Challenges Ahead
Despite the momentum, participants acknowledge numerous obstacles in achieving climate goals.
Key Challenges:
- Economic Barriers: Many developing nations face financial limitations in implementing green technologies and policies.
- Political Resistance: Varying political priorities and resistance from certain sectors can hinder unified action.
- Public Awareness: There is a need for heightened public engagement and education on the importance of climate initiatives.
